The Genesis of Polar

Polar was born in Finland in 1977 with a vision to make exercise and health insights accessible to all. The company began by developing heart rate monitors, a trailblazing step in an era when such technology was still in its infancy. Their innovation has paved the way for countless advancements in fitness technology, and today, Polar stands as a leader in the industry, continually pushing the envelope.

It's interesting to note that the inspiration behind Polar's inception stemmed from a simple need—a way for athletes to monitor their heart rates during training. Just imagine how that one small idea has evolved into a comprehensive suite of tools catering to everyday fitness enthusiasts and serious athletes alike. By staying true to their roots while adapting to modern technological trends, Polar has successfully merged traditional sports science with cutting-edge technology.

Advanced Heart Rate Monitoring

Heart rate monitoring is crucial for anyone engaged in physical training. Polar watches have integrated advanced heart rate sensors that do far more than just measure beats per minute. They employ optical sensors that capture blood flow through the skin, providing a detailed picture of one’s heart rate both during workouts and at rest. This is significant because it allows users to understand their heart's response to various intensities of exercise.

Moreover, users can leverage heart rate data to tailor their workouts, aiming for specific heart rate zones that optimize fat burning, aerobic capacity, or even recovery. The ability to analyze this information paves the way for better decision-making in training regimens. As stated by a seasoned fitness coach, "Understanding your heart rate is like having a personal trainer on your wrist; it tells you when to push harder and when to take a break."

Sleep Tracking and Recovery Insights

Recovery is as essential as the workout itself. Polar watches include sophisticated sleep tracking features that go beyond counting hours of rest. They measure sleep stages—light, deep, and REM—offering insights into the quality of sleep the wearer is getting. This knowledge can be transformational for those seeking to optimize their recovery process.

Using the data accumulated, users receive personalized feedback about their recovery and overall health. This includes insights on how the previous day’s activities affected their sleep quality, allowing for informed adjustments in approach to training. Water Resistance and Ruggedness

Water resistance is another significant aspect of Polar watches. Fitness activities often take place in various environments, be it rain-soaked trails or sweaty gym sessions. Polar ensures that its watches are equipped with solid water resistance ratings, allowing users to dive into workouts without worry. For example, the Polar Grit X is engineered to handle depths of up to 100 meters, which means you can swim, shower, or even just wash your hands without thinking twice about removing it.

Moreover, many models boast ruggedness that goes beyond mere waterproofing. Features such as reinforced casing, solid push buttons, and resistance to extreme temperatures ensure that these watches can handle whatever life throws their way. Such durability is imperative for fitness enthusiasts who often venture off the beaten path into challenging terrains.

Integration with Mobile Apps

The synergy between Polar watches and mobile applications forms a cornerstone of their appeal. With the Polar Flow app, users can sync their fitness data effortlessly, allowing for an in-depth analysis of their performance over time. Tracking workouts, setting goals, and viewing progress on a mobile device brings users closer to understanding their fitness journey in a holistic manner.

Additionally, these apps enable personalized training plans—these aren’t one-size-fits-all solutions. Instead, they cater to the individual, adjusting based on workout history and specific goals. This personal touch can be vital for those looking to push their limits safely. Thus, integration with mobile apps is not merely a feature; it’s a game-changer.

Connectivity and Syncing Features

Connectivity is another crucial aspect of the Polar watches experience. Users benefit from a straightforward syncing process, often involving a simple Bluetooth connection. Once paired with a smartphone, not only can data be transmitted with ease, but users can also receive notifications about calls and messages directly on their wrist. This functionality is vital, keeping users connected without the need to pull out their phones mid-workout.

The syncing capabilities also extend to integrating with other fitness platforms, such as Strava or MyFitnessPal. This versatility allows users to cross-reference their data across multiple platforms, which enhances understandability and provides a more complete picture of their health. For many, this interconnectedness represents an elevation of the traditional fitness tracker into a well-rounded digital ecosystem.

Comparison with Other Leading Brands

When placing Polar watches in the spotlight, it's crucial to compare them with industry frontrunners such as Garmin, Fitbit, and Apple. Each brand comes to the table with its unique features, specifications, and pricing models, therefore a granular examination highlights several key factors:

  • Performance Metrics: Garmin is often touted for its advanced GPS technology. Their watches are a favorite among serious runners and cyclists. In contrast, Polar provides an impressive heart-rate monitoring system that often vouches for accuracy.
  • User Interface & Experience: Apple watches have an edge when it comes to ecosystem integration. Their compatibility with other Apple products enhances user experience. Polar watches, while not as glamorous, offer a straightforward user interface focused on efficiency in workout tracking.
  • Cost Considerations: Pricing can greatly influence choice. For instance, while Polar is typically positioned at a mid-range price point, brands like Fitbit offer more budget-friendly options, drawing in casual users who may prioritize affordability over advanced functionality.

These aspects not only help potential buyers see where each brand excels but also emphasize Polar’s distinct advantages or shortcomings.

Cost Comparison with Competitors

When it comes to cost comparison, examining Polar watches alongside their competitors offers essential insights. Brands like Garmin, Fitbit, and Apple have their own niches, all boasting various features that cater to a wide range of consumers. However, Polar distinguishes itself with a price point that often delivers more bang for your buck.

  • Competitive Pricing: Many Polar models are priced similarly to devices from other brands but generally offer advanced functionalities. For instance, models like the Polar Vantage V2 provide robust features at a lower price compared to the Garmin Forerunner 945.
  • Notable Examples:
  • Polar M430: A fitness-focused option priced around $200, comparable to the Fitbit Charge 4 but often regarded for its more accurate heart rate monitoring.
  • Polar Grit X: This rugged outdoor watch sells for about $600, placing it within the range of similarly positioned Garmin watches but offering unique training tools that set it apart.

Comparisons reveal that while initial costs may seem similar, ** Polar watches often deliver with added features** that appeal to those seriously committed to their fitness journeys.
